THAVAASMI ( means "I belong to you")

- LAUNCHED BY HIS EXCELLENCY THE VICE PRESIDENT OF INDIA, SRIMAN M.VENKAIAH NAIDU GARU

Approach: Ramayana and Bhagavadgeetha are presented as mirrors and lifelines of humanity. Ramayana presented with Human Angle

Language: English

Structure of the book: Entire content is divided into 4 Volumes and 68 days


Uniqueness:

1. Content is presented as a Dialogue between a father (Mr.Aditya) and daughter(Thavaasmi). 

2. Authentic

3. Comprehensive Analysis of each character, virtue, situation in Ramayana

4. Practice and introspection made easy using Comparison Mirrors, Introspection Mirrors, Media Reporting, Character Presentation, Research questions, Now and then tasks, contemporary relevance etc.

5. Aesthetic richness through situational images

6. Mind maps are used to make assimilation easy.
